Essential recovery aid for total knee replacement
There are numerous knee support devices available online, but this is the only one I could find that offers 0° of flexion when your leg is elevated. Most of them have a slight bend behind the knee, which is absolutely contraindicated after a total knee replacement. Doctors recommend sleeping with your leg elevated on pillows under the ankle, and without anything behind your knee. This full leg pillow does the exactly the job, but with a lot more comfort. My physical therapist said hospitals should be discharging patients with these pillows. I’ve read complaints about the fact that it’s in two parts and sometimes comes apart. Just buy a crib sheet and that will keep the entire pillow together while you sleep (and is washable). Your physical therapist will have you use the ankle support separately for other extension exercises (which are ouch!) I’m 10 days post-TKR, and it’s a painful recovery, but at least this pillow makes sleeping a bit more comfortable. I know it’s expensive but do yourself a favor, it’s hard enough getting through a TKR - take advantage of all the available props and aids, and this, in my opinion, is an essential one. I still think it’s overly priced for a big piece of foam. I wish other companies would get on the bandwagon so they could bring the prices down with a bit of healthy competition :-/ but c’est la vie…

Super overpriced but possibly helpful to knee replacement
I bought this for my recovery of a partial knee replacement. Positives: It’s a significant elevation for the leg which is difficult to attain with regular pillows. It keeps the knee perfectly straight, which is important after replacement. Negatives: outrageously expensive for a pieces of shaped foam. The foam does not have a cover nor does it have any means for the two parts of the foam to stay together, so it can’t really be shifted without coming apart. I used a throw blanket on it to keep it clean and keep my skin from rubbing on it, bit it did not keep it pulled together. It’s a magnet for hair - pet and human. It was also easy to take chunks out of it if you’re not careful. I’m not sure if I’d buy this again. It’s helped my recovery (I think) but it really should come with a cover and be much, much less expensive.
